Output 579989576fa33b593ce83774b76bd09dd4251d60cf6fd7fba92ed4fe90eb8ed8:1

value
51098591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5058ebf127dbd1e4be8f5409aed31edf99b2a408 OP_EQUAL
address
MFDzpAJ6zR4ieyY4bD565GhDWEdCrJkfX7
transaction
579989576fa33b593ce83774b76bd09dd4251d60cf6fd7fba92ed4fe90eb8ed8
spent
true